The World Turned Upside Down: Radical Ideas During the English Revolution by Christopher Hill is a compelling exploration that draws readers into the heart of a transformative period in history. This insightful narrative delves into the radical ideologies that emerged during the English Revolution, offering a fresh perspective on how these ideas shaped modern thought and society.
As a crucial work in the non-fiction genre, particularly within British history, Hill’s book serves as an essential resource for anyone interested in the complexities of a pivotal era. The author masterfully intertwines historical events with the revolutionary ideas that challenged the status quo, revealing the profound impact of these radical thinkers.
